Yet Another Feather for Olori Janet Afolabi

Olori Janet Afolabi, CNN award-winning journalist and Queen of Apomu Kingdom, has forever proven that milk of kindness runs in her.  Since her husband ascended the throne of his forefathers, her humanitarian gestures have been felt by many around the kingdom, particularly, women and school children.

So, it was not surprising when recently she emerged as Most Outstanding Innovative Humanitarian Personality of the Year, at the 7th Prestige Excellence Award and Lecture.

The award was given to Olori Afolabi for the innovative nature of the financial aid she gives to indigent and vulnerable market women in Apomu, headquarters of Isokan local government area of Osun state.

Since 2020, Olori Afolabi has been assisting many women with no-interest loans for them to expand their businesses or start new ones. The financial aid began after the Covid-19 lockdown when many businesses were devastated.

Olori Afolabi said she started the programme as a simple act of kindness. “But today it has become my flagship project.”

She dedicated the award to God for using her as a vessel to drive financial development in her community.

The award, which was held on November 12, at the Civic Centre, Ozumba Mbadiwe Road, Victoria Island, Lagos, is the brainchild of Prestige News Online and Prestige International Magazine. It is dedicated to extolling the virtue of hard work and uncommon achievements.

 Wale Abiodun, Executive Director, Prestige Excellence Award and Lecture said the award is also aimed at celebrating and honouring deserving individuals, corporate bodies and professional institutions that have made remarkable impact on society.
